RRB Group D exam held on 5th September 2022 (Shift 1) consisted of 100 questions to be attempted in 90 minutes, covering Mathematics, General Intelligence & Reasoning, General Science, and General Awareness. The overall difficulty level was easy to moderate, with Reasoning and Mathematics being relatively simpler and General Science slightly more conceptual. Time management and accuracy were crucial for a good score.
